Fun-filled family day out at the sixth annual Kidbrooke Village fete
Live music and traditional fairground rides and activities will transform Cator Park into a fun-filled family day out with the sixth annual Kidbrooke Village fête on Saturday, August 4.
This year’s free community event runs from midday to 5pm and will see the return of the popular street food vendors which attended the Kidbrooke Village Street Food Fest at the end of June.
There will also be a circus workshop for kids, a giant games area, face painting, family photo session, coconut shy and hook-a-duck.
or the competitive types, there will also be popular sports day games including the three legged race, sack race, egg and spoon race and a tug of war.
There will be stalls from the regular Kidbrooke Village Farmers’ Market, which takes place on the first Saturday of every month, the London Wildlife Trust, Safer Neighbourhood team, Girl Guides, South London Scouts and many more.
